摘要
Pectins isolated from sugar beet pulp by autoclaving contained significant amounts of ferulates, 8.8% of which were ferulate dehydrodimers. The 8-8 and 8-O-4 dehydrodimers were predominant. Oxidative cross-linking with hydrogen peroxide/peroxidase lowered the amount of ferulic acid by 78%, while an increase in ferulate dehydrodimers by a factor of 4.9 was observed. The highest increase was seen for the 8-5 and 8-O-4 dehydrodimers. The concentration of total ferulates decreased by 36% after cross-linking, indicating that a part of the ferulates were converted to unidentified oxidation products, It was concluded that ferulic acid in beet pulp pectin is coupled into a variety of dehydrodimers by treatments that mediate oxidative cross-linking reactions.
